Discover the enchanting Taiga, a hidden world in the northern reaches of Mongolia, where the Tsaatan people continue their age-old tradition of reindeer herding. Reaching this remote region requires a 7–8-hour horseback journey, immersing you in the stunning landscapes that define the Tsaatan way of life.
The Tsaatan community thrives in two primary areas: East Taiga and West Taiga, each offering a glimpse into their unique culture and sustainable lifestyle. At the heart of their world lies White Nuur Sum, strategically positioned between these two regions and serving as the central hub for the Tsaatan people.
